Conquering New York State

The Big Apple Academy’s Math Department is a proud participant in the annual National Math League. Every year, our students make us exceptionally proud by representing the school and competing with other students on the national level. This year is no exception! The team of our sevenths graders outperformed all other participants placing our school in First Place in New York State. Our sixth and eighth graders won second and third place, respectively, leaving behind 73 top New York State schools. We applaud to all our champions and congratulate parents and teachers who made this significant victory possible!
